2003 H2 Tranny Hard Shifting
 
I everyone, I have researched around a little but still not sure what the problem is. My tranny is having trouble shifting from 1st to 2nd and into 3rd, it will not go into overdrive. It will not manually shift out of third into overdrive. I checked the tranny fluid and it was a little low, so I added the correct dexron III as in the manual.

My first thing i was planning on doing was changing out the tranny fluid, but would like to put my money in the right place instead of wasting money on things that will not correct the problem.

I hope I don't need to replace the tranny and it is a TPS issue or something like that.

Believe it or not, my tranny just went out on mine Saturday while driving to Austin. I was 100 miles away from the house when I decided to accelerate past a slower moving vehicle on the frwy. As I attempted to pass, the rpms just shot up, but the H2 didn't move any faster.

I pulled of to the side of the road to t=check the tranny fluid which "supposedly" had just been checked the Monday before at the shop and said it was full. I didn't look myself prior to hitting the road, which I should have, but nonetheless the fluid was below the lower marker on the stick. I had some tranny fluid in the car, so I added some. I let the tranny cool down for a bit before starting down the road again, and the same thing happened. 1st gear was ok, 2nd gear, was ok, but no 3rd!! RPMS skyrocketed again.

Pulled over a second time thinking it needed to cool a bit longer. While I waited, I did some internet research only to read the possibilities of what I already knew. About 20 minutes passed and I started down the road again, but now the "check engine" light was on. This time I noticed it didn't take off in DRIVE as easy as it had before. 1st gear ok, but now no 2nd...I'm like WTH because now I'm in the middle of nowhere (Troy, TX) and now I can hear the tranny whining which it wasn't doing before.

Pull over a 3rd time, now DRIVE is pretty much gone, and absolutely no REVERSE. I call a wrecker, wait 2 hours watching the in-dash DVD (money well spent), and $350 later, the wrecker drops me off at home and takes the Hummer to the shop.

$1300 complete rebuild, 3year or 36k warranty...should pick it up Friday (hopefully):clapping:

I had a similar thing happen in my 03 tahoe I used to have.

I was driving, came to a stop sign, yielded preceded to go and wham, hardly anything, ended up driving 4 miles to a local gas station, my dad came and he manually put it into 2nd gear, drove to our houyse then to aamco, all in 2nd, ended up being the 3rd-4th gear packet going out

I do not reccomend Aamco while were at it, it was still slipping and I couldn't get them to do anything, and I've seen cases where they put used from a junkyard parts into their rebuilt trannies.

I have 1,500 miles left of warranty on my 03, it's starting to do a little bit of slipping every now and then but i doubt it will go out before 1,500 so... w/e

I really hate the idea of rebuilding a 4l65e to put back in it, knowing full well it's to small for the truck, but question my ability to swap in the 4l80e and associated parts
